Twin Twist

Previous Mold Use: Titans Return Deluxe Class Topspin, Legends Deluxe Class Topspin, Titans Return Deluxe Class Twin Twist, Legends Deluxe Class Twin Twist

Twin Twist’s paintjob is based on Diaclone colors, and they did not give him some idiotic name or a Diaclone bio like UnFunPub did with some Diaclone homages. I like the paintjob, unfortunately, the mold must be in sorry shape. His joints are crazy loose, and his waist doesn’t want to stay together.

Overall: This one is worth getting if only because the mold has degraded so much, we are unlikely to ever get a Diaclone Topspin, so it’s your last chance to get the mold.
